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9870992 8335573355 256 40909
028880 7281251
028880 7281251
436 55472 158094 87896
All about undefined
Interested in learning more?
028880 7281251
436 55472 158094 87896
See more
6410919 57898
61908670 549466 0823 86
See more
9157200328 458350816
999007 55 5161548969 3622 33
See more